Since eBible has changed their delivery method, I've been trying to figure out if I can add their new VerseLink feature to our website. There is one line of javascript that needs to be added anywhere between the head tags of the site (see link: http://www.ebible.com/developers), but I'm not sure a. if it will work, and b. where is the best place to put this code so that I only have to put it in one place. In the Setup Field of the Root Template add the following: page.headerData.25 = TEXT page.headerData.25.value ( <script type="text/javascript"> YOUR SCRIPT </script> ) I'm not sure it will work, but that's how you add header stuff to your page.
